I must say, Nokia’s phones these days tend to look minimalistic in order to keep up with the times, and looks can be rather deceiving at times since most of their handsets in the entry level and mid-range tend to look far better than they perform in terms of hardware specifications. The Nokia X2-05 that comes in a candy bar form factor will place more emphasis on music and media, where it handles MP3 and MP4 files, boasting a loudspeaker that operates at 106 phons – which ought to be loud enough to keep an entire room entertained.

Other hardware specifications include an FM radio with a recording facility, a VGA camera at the back, a 2.2″ QVGA display at 320 x 240 resolution, a microSD memory card slot to further increase the amount of music and movies that you want to tore around, and GSM Dual Band 900/1800 support. You will be able to select from black, silver, white and bright red colors, where the Nokia X2-05 is tipped to ship sometime in the fourth quarter for around 46 Euros. [Press Release]
